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
Reasonable Accommodations Statement
To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ential function and basic duty satisfactorily.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able qualified individ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ions and basic duties.
Essential Functions Statement(s)
  • Design and facilitate effective training programs for customers to educate them on the programs and processes.
  • Design, prepare, and coordinate the resources necessary to facilitate education and influence behavior.
  • Conduct training needs assessments and identify skills or knowledge gaps that need to be addressed.
  • Market available training opportunities to the audience and provide the necessary information. 
  • Improve training effectiveness by developing new approaches and techniques, making support readily available.  
  • Learn and maintain the knowledge necessary to be the subject matter expert with regard to program updates and business processes.
  • Regularly evaluate resources and processes to ensure effectiveness is maintained and effectively communicate any changes to all necessary parties.
  • Present complex information to a wide range of audiences utilizing various training methods.
  • Develop and maintain positive working relationships with other team members within the department and throughout the organization to assist in the growth of programs and company initiatives.
  • Other duties as assigned by management.
  • Regular and prompt attendance at work is a primary function and requirement of this position.
